問題タブ [qbwc]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
quickbooks - アプリケーションを QuickBooks Web Connector に追加する
アプリケーションをQuickBooks Web Connectorに追加しようとしています。QuickBooks POS 2013 試用版がインストールされています。.qwc ファイルを Web コネクタに追加すると、次のことが起こります。
- Authorize new web service ポップアップが開きます - OKをクリックして、Web サービスへのアクセスを許可します。
- 利用可能な POS サーバーを示すポップアップが表示されます。このリストは空です。OKを押します
- 会社のデータとサーバー ワークステーションに関する詳細を尋ねるポップアップが表示されます。ポップアップには次の情報が含まれます。
次のデータに接続するサーバー ワークステーションのコンピュータ名と会社名を入力してください:ここに何を入力しますか?
サーバー ワークステーションのコンピューター名:ここには何を入力しますか?
これらのフィールドの値を教えてください。
注: Web コネクタと QBPOS の両方がローカル マシンにインストールされています。
iis - リクエストの最大長を超えました
QuickBooks Web コネクタと IIS 7 で ItemQueryRq に応答して次のエラーを受け取るユーザーがいます。
バージョン: 1.6
メッセージ: ReceiveResponseXML が失敗しました
説明: QBWC1042: ReceiveResponseXML が失敗しました エラー メッセージ: 構成ファイルで指定された拡張機能を実行中に例外が発生しました。--> リクエストの最大長を超えました。詳細については、QWCLog を参照してください。ログオンをオンにすることを忘れないでください。
ログは、以前のリクエストが
QBWebConnector.SOAPWebService.ProcessRequestXML() : QuickBooks から受信した応答: サイズ (バイト) = 3048763
IIS 7 では、コンテンツの最大許容長が 30000000 に設定されているため、この応答を許可するために何を変更する必要があるかわかりません。誰かが私を正しい方向に向けることができますか?
quickbooks - QuickBooks Web コネクタのテスト
Quickbooks Web コネクタと対話するためのサービスとしてのソフトウェア アプリケーションで Web サービスを開発しました。
開発中に発見したことの 1 つは、QuickBook のバージョンが異なれば、XML スキーマのバージョンも異なるということです。そのため、さまざまなスキーマに対応できる柔軟性を備えたアプリケーションが開発されました。
2 つの質問: - これらはどこに完全に文書化されていますか? - QuickBooks のさまざまなバージョンをすべて購入して維持することなく、[選択した] さまざまなバージョンをテストするにはどうすればよいですか?
quickbooks - Web コネクタを使用してクイック ブック データを asp.net アプリケーションに統合する
• asp.net を使用しています。クイック ブックのデータを asp.net アプリケーションに統合する必要があります。
• com オブジェクトを使用する Silverlight アプリケーションでは、QB に接続し、そこから Company name を選択してデータを取得できます。
• しかし、これらすべてを iis から実行する必要があります。そのため、com オブジェクトを使用してデータ com オブジェクトを取得することはできません。
そこで、Web コネクタを選択しました。
私の要件は次のとおりです。
ユーザーインターフェイスから会社のデータベースを選択します
その後、顧客、ベンダーなどのデータを取得する必要があります。
そのデータをデータベースにインポートする必要があります。
しかし、Web コネクタを使用すると、シナリオが異なります…</p>
- これを使用して、最初の .qwc ファイルを選択する必要があります。これは、Web サービスを呼び出しています。そこからデータを取得します。
コーディングを介して Web コネクタを呼び出すことは可能ですか…..そこから Web サービスを呼び出します…</p>
または、.qwc ファイルを選択しない他の解決策はありますか
quickbooks - QBXML で預金からトランザクション ラインを削除するには?
請求書と請求書を変更する場合、明細項目を問題なく処理できます。アイテムを追加するには、に設定しTxnLineID
、-1
アイテムを削除するには、mod リクエストに含めないだけです。TxnLineID
したがって、後で mod をすべて mod に保存する代わりに-1
、現在のすべてのアイテムを効果的に削除し、元に戻したいすべてのアイテムを追加します。この方法は、預金には当てはまらないようです。トランザクション ラインでデポジットが正常に作成された場合は、0 ラインで mod リクエストを実行します。デポジットにはまだ 1 つのトランザクションが関連付けられています。
このリクエストは正常に処理されましたが、レスポンスには元のDepositLine
.
OCRを見ると、デポジットを削除して新しいデポジットを作成する必要があるようです。そこにもっと良いオプションはありますか?
soap - QuickBooks Web コネクタを使用した認証の問題: オブジェクト参照がオブジェクトのインスタンスに設定されていません
QuickBooks Web コネクタからの接続を処理するための SOAP サーバーがあります。それが呼び出す最初のメソッドは「認証」であり、期待するデータを正しく返しますが、エラーが発生します
私はこれに途方に暮れており、ウェブ上に解決策がないようです。エラーメッセージは、実際には何もしません。
これに関する詳細情報をどこで探すことができるか誰かが知っているなら、私は感謝します.
この問題の WC エラー ログは次のとおりです。
WC に送信される SOAP 応答: